How to fill out Checklist for (Private) Administrative Subdivision Application

01
Gather all necessary documentation including property deeds, surveys, and maps.
02
Complete the application form for the Administrative Subdivision.
03
Fill out the checklist by ensuring each item is addressed; refer to local regulations for specific requirements.
04
Provide proof of ownership or consent from property owners if applicable.
05
Attach any required maps or diagrams that show the proposed subdivision layout.
06
Submit the completed checklist and application to the appropriate local government office.
07
Pay any associated fees that may be required for processing the application.
08
Wait for a confirmation receipt and follow up if necessary for additional steps or approvals.

The Checklist for (Private) Administrative Subdivision Application is a document that outlines the necessary requirements and steps that must be followed when applying for the subdivision of private properties.
Any individual or entity seeking to subdivide their private property into smaller lots or parcels is required to file the Checklist for (Private) Administrative Subdivision Application.
To fill out the Checklist for (Private) Administrative Subdivision Application, applicants should carefully review each item on the checklist, provide the required information and documentation, and ensure all sections are completed accurately before submission.
The purpose of the Checklist for (Private) Administrative Subdivision Application is to ensure that applicants provide all necessary information and meet local requirements for the subdivision process, facilitating a smoother review and approval process.
Information that must be reported on the Checklist for (Private) Administrative Subdivision Application typically includes applicant details, property boundaries, proposed lot configurations, compliance with zoning regulations, and any additional documentation required by local authorities.
